Searching for hardware digitally requires a slightly various technique than strolling down an aisle at a local hardware store. Keep these tips in mind to make sure a smooth buying experience:
- Watch Out for Counterfeits: When purchasing popular brand names like Milwaukee or Makita on massive open-marketplace sites like Amazon or eBay, constantly verify that the seller is an authorized dealership. Fake batteries and Power Tools Online tools are a safety danger and will void producer guarantees.
- Consider Shipping Weight: Heavy items-- such as cast-iron table saws, work benches, or heavy tool chests-- can sustain massive freight charges. Always inspect the store's freight shipping policy before clicking checkout.
- Search For Bare Tool vs. Kit Options: Power Electrical Tools Online are often sold as "bare tools" (tool just, no battery or battery charger) or "kits" (consists of batteries, charger, and a bag). Verify the listing details so you do not wind up with a cordless drill and no method to power it.
- Leverage Reconditioned Tools: If dealing with a tight spending plan, search for factory-reconditioned tools sold straight by licensed sellers. These products are tested, fixed, and licensed by the producer, frequently coming with a steep discount and a solid service warranty.
Often Asked Questions (FAQ)Q1: Is it safe to buy power tools online?
A: Yes, as long as you Buy Power Tools from reliable, authorized online tool shops or straight from the manufacturer's site. Prevent unknown third-party sellers offering rates that appear "too good to be true," as these are often counterfeit products.
Q2: Which online store has the very best deals on power tools?
A: Big-box stores like Home Depot and specialized sellers like Acme Tools often run vacation promos (such as Father's Day, Black Friday, and Spring Black Friday) featuring "Buy a Tool, Get a Free Battery" package deals.
Q3: What should I do if a tool shows up damaged or malfunctioning?
A: Contact the retailer's consumer support instantly. Authorized online tool shops normally offer a prepaid return label for defective products. If the return window has actually closed, you will require to take the tool to a local authorized service center covered under the manufacturer's service warranty.
Q4: Are reconditioned tools worth buying?
A: Absolutely. Factory-reconditioned tools have been inspected, evaluated, and brought back to factory specs. They frequently function as excellent as brand-new and can conserve buyers anywhere from 20% to 40% off market prices.
